Well, after following this thread for a long time and seeing the great photos taken with this lens I jumped in and bought a refurb from Canon for $ 1495. Next, I'll be looking for the 1.4X III extender as it seems to be a popular combination for birding. My Tamron 150-600 can get the job done but occasionally it can be frustrating waiting for it to lock focus on fast moving subjects such as eagles fishing and battling over their catch.
